About Me

Dr. Thomas Fitzsimmons is a board-certified ophthalmologist with fellowship training in oculoplastic and reconstructive surgery. He treats a wide variety of eye conditions, including cataracts, glaucoma, diabetic retinopathy, dry eye, and thyroid eye disease. He also specializes in conditions affecting the eyelids and surrounding structures, such as drooping or baggy eyelids, excessive tearing, lesions, and skin cancers around the eyes, and performs cosmetic eyelid surgery.

Dr. Fitzsimmons’ approach to care focuses on achieving the best outcome with minimal pain, bruising, and scarring. He joined Summit Health Eye Care in 2006. Prior to that, he served as Chief of Oculoplastic and Reconstructive Surgery and Assistant Professor of Ophthalmology at the University of Texas Health Science Center. He earned his medical degree from the University of Michigan, completed his ophthalmology residency at the Mayo Clinic, and received subspecialty training in oculoplastic and orbital surgery at the University of Texas in Dallas. He also holds a Master of Public Health degree and has served with the U.S. Public Health Service and the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ention.
